Job description
About the Role
This position is located at 2941 Makkah Al Mukarramah Road,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. It is a full-time, non-management role based onsite and involves supporting various human resources administrative functions within the luxury hotel operations of St. Regis Hotels & Resorts.
Key Responsibilities
- Answer incoming phone calls and document messages accurately.
- Establish and maintain organized filing systems for applicant and employee records.
- Manage employment application files, including processing and tracking.
- Create and prepare office correspondence using computer systems.
- Audit payroll distributions and assist with paycheck coordination.
- Communicate with successful job applicants regarding required documentation for employment verification (I-9 forms).
- Create new employee personnel files and update employee communication bulletin boards with recruitment, transfer, promotion, and relevant employment information.
- Post all legally mandated human resource notices visibly for employees as required by law.
- Adhere to all company safety and security policies and promptly report any accidents, injuries, or unsafe conditions to management.
- Maintain professional personal appearance and ensure confidentiality of proprietary company information and assets.
- Provide assistance to colleagues to ensure adequate coverage and excellent guest service.
- Develop and maintain positive working relationships supporting team goals; communicate effectively using professional language and telephone etiquette.
- Use computer systems and point of sale systems to enter and retrieve work-related data.
- Perform light physical tasks such as lifting, moving, or carrying objects up to 10 pounds without assistance.
- Complete other reasonable duties as assigned by supervisors.
Qualifications
- Educational Requirement: High school diploma or equivalent (G.E.D.).
- Experience: Minimum of 1 year of relevant work experience in a similar setting.
- Supervisory Experience: Not required.
- Licenses/Certifications: None specified.
